So why does this happen? Or more importantly How do I fix it?
This only shows up when the assembly is rendered.
The part rendered by itself is ok

View attachment 4268
 
Make sure your 'Shade quality' is set to 10 in your 'Model Display'. 'Edge/Line' quality should be sufficient at medium. If you set the edgle/line quality to 'very high' you may find your system RAM being eaten up.


This should sort your problem.
